Is Silicone Cookware Safe To Use In The Oven?

Is silicone cookware safe to use in the oven?

Silicone cookware is generally considered safe to use in the oven, but it’s essential to follow certain guidelines to ensure its longevity and safety. Most silicone cookware can withstand high temperatures, typically up to 500°F (260°C), but it’s crucial to check the manufacturer’s instructions for the specific temperature limit of your product. Some silicone cookware may be labeled as “oven-safe” or “BPA-free,” which can give you a good starting point.

When using silicone cookware in the oven, it’s also essential to avoid extreme temperature changes, such as going from the freezer to the oven. This can cause the silicone to degrade or become brittle, leading to potential cracks or breaks. Additionally, never leave silicone cookware in the oven unattended, as it can melt or deform if subjected to high temperatures for an extended period. To ensure the safety and performance of your silicone cookware, always follow the manufacturer’s recommendations and guidelines for use.

Some silicone cookware products, such as silicone mats or baking sheets, are specifically designed for high-temperature baking and can withstand the heat of a conventional oven. In these cases, the silicone material is often reinforced with additional materials, such as fiberglass or ceramic, to enhance its durability and resistance to heat. However, it’s still crucial to check the manufacturer’s specifications and guidelines for use to ensure the best results and to prevent any potential damage to your cookware.

If you’re unsure about the safety or performance of your silicone cookware in the oven, it’s always best to err on the side of caution and consult the manufacturer’s instructions or seek advice from a cooking expert. With proper use and care, silicone cookware can be a safe and convenient option for a wide range of cooking tasks, from baking and roasting to sautéing and steaming.

Can silicone cookware be used in the microwave?

Silicone cookware is generally safe to use in the microwave, but it’s essential to follow some guidelines. Most silicone cookware products are labeled as microwave-safe, and their flexibility allows heat to distribute evenly. However, it’s crucial to check the manufacturer’s instructions, as some silicone products may have specific guidelines or restrictions on microwave use. It’s also worth noting that high-quality, food-grade silicone is the safest option for microwave cooking. Cheap or inferior silicone products may release chemical fumes or melt when heated in the microwave.

When using silicone cookware in the microwave, it’s vital to heat it at a moderate power level to prevent hotspots or overheating. Additionally, avoid leaving silicone cookware unattended as it heats up quickly and can burn your skin. Never microwave silicone cookware with metal objects or aluminum foil, as this can cause sparks or even a fire. As with any cookware, it’s essential to handle and clean silicone cookware properly to ensure its longevity and food safety.

Is silicone cookware durable and long-lasting?

Silicone cookware has gained popularity in recent years due to its non-stick, heat-resistant, and durable properties. One of the notable advantages of silicone cookware is its resilience to scratches and cracks, making it a long-lasting option for cooking. It can withstand extreme temperatures, from freezing to oven temperatures of up to 500°F (260°C), without showing signs of degradation.

In addition to its temperature endurance, silicone cookware is also resistant to corrosion and can easily clean with mild soap and water. The non-perforation of the silicone material allows for easy food release and does not harbor bacteria or other microorganisms, which is essential for maintaining good hygiene in the kitchen. Furthermore, silicone cookware is not a fire hazard like some other non-stick cookware options, providing an added layer of safety for home cooks and professional chefs alike.

When compared to other non-stick cookware options such as Teflon, silicone cookware has a higher heat resistance, as well as improved durability. However, while silicone cookware is generally long-lasting, prolonged exposure to heat can cause it to become brittle and prone to cracking. When proper care is taken, this typically does not happen within a reasonable timeframe. In conclusion, silicone cookware offers a proven track record of durability and long-lasting performance, especially when used and stored under optimal conditions.
